JSP中MD5加密实例详解从原理到方法

汽车配件 2025-10-22

在Web开发过程中,数据的安全性是一个非常重要的环节。为了保证用户数据的安全,我们通常会使用加密技术。MD5加密是一种常用的加密算法,本文将详细介绍JSP中如何使用MD5加密,包括其原理、实现方法以及一个具体的实例。

一、MD5加密简介

MD5(Message-Digest Algorithm 5)是一种广泛使用的密码散列函数,可以产生一个128位(16字节)的散列值(hash value),通常用一个32位的十六进制数字表示。MD5加密的特点是速度快,但安全性相对较低,容易受到暴力破解的攻击。

JSP中MD5加密实例详解从原理到方法

二、JSP中实现MD5加密

在JSP中实现MD5加密,主要可以分为以下几个步骤:

1. 引入MD5加密类:首先需要在JSP页面中引入Java的MD5加密类,该类位于`java.security.MessageDigest`包中。

2. 获取MD5加密对象:使用`MessageDigest`类创建一个MD5加密对象。

3. 加密数据:将需要加密的数据转换为字节数组,然后使用加密对象进行加密处理。

4. 获取加密后的数据:将加密后的字节数组转换为十六进制字符串。

下面是一个简单的JSP示例,演示如何使用MD5加密一段文本:

```jsp

<%@ page import="

举报
jsp中加入jsp实例_JSP中加入JSP实例实战与方法分享
« 上一篇 2025-10-22
JSP中传递变量实例实战与方法分享
下一篇 » 2025-10-22